Emergency Channel Decision And Contract Coordination Of Closed-loop Supply Chain Under Product Recall

Due to the technology immatured,the bloated management organization,and the quality of the enterprise is not effectively controlled,the products will have serious quality problems after a period of use.According to the relevant provisions of China's "Defective Consumer Goods Recall Measures",companies had to recall the defective products.Therefore,under the product recalls,how closed-loop supply chains make decisions,ensure the economic and ecological benefits has become an urgent problem to be solved in the current era,and the existing theoretical results are rarely.Therefore,this article intends to study the following:(1)In response to product recalls,built manufacturers recycling,retailers recycling,and third-party recycling closed-loop supply chain emergency decision-making model to analyze how companies choose the best emergency recycling channel after a product recall occurs;(2)In order to solve the problem of "dual marginal effect" in the decentralized closed-loop supply chain under product recalls,designed emergency revenue sharing contracts and two fee contracts.All members of the closed-loop supply chain can obtain Pareto improved profits in order to effectively respond to product recalls.The research found that the retailer's recycling mode under product recall is an effective recycling channel;after the product recall incident,manufacturers have to bear more processing costs when handling products,so the operational efficiency of centralized decision closed-loop supply chain is not always excellent;the emergency revenue sharing contract and the two charging contracts can effectively coordinate the decentralized decision-making behavior of each member under product recall,and enable manufacturers and retailers to obtain Pareto improved profit.
